How a Real Estate Virtual Assistant Can Support Client Communication


Real estate clients often have questions about appointments, documents, deadlines, and next steps. When an agent is handling showings or negotiations, responding to every routine inquiry immediately can be difficult.

A Virtual Assistant can support client communication without replacing the agent’s personal relationship with the client.

What Can a Virtual Assistant Handle?

With clear instructions and approved templates, a VA may assist with:

  • Scheduling showings and appointments
  • Sending appointment confirmations
  • Providing routine status updates
  • Requesting missing documents
  • Sharing approved contact information
  • Following up on administrative requests
  • Organizing client questions for the agent
  • Escalating urgent or sensitive messages

The National Association of REALTORS® notes that assistants can communicate with clients to arrange showings, answer logistical questions, and provide routine updates.

Why Does Consistency Matter?

Clients should receive clear information regardless of who handles the initial message. Salesforce found that 79% of customers expect consistent interactions across departments, while 56% often have to repeat information to different representatives.

A shared communication process can help prevent this frustration. Client notes, previous updates, and outstanding questions should be recorded in one organized system.

What Should Remain With the Agent?

The agent should personally handle communication involving:

  • Real estate advice
  • Pricing discussions
  • Contract interpretation
  • Negotiations
  • Complaints or sensitive concerns
  • Decisions requiring licensed judgment

A VA should know which questions can be answered and which must be immediately forwarded to the agent.
